In a planned economy, which of the following does the job of market forces in
mojhsa [17]

Answer:

A. the government

Explanation:

In the planned economy, the government control every factor of productions. All the resources that exist within the country are owned by the government. On top of that, the government also specifically controlled the type of economic activities that can and can't be done by the people.

This create a situation where people have no freedom to choose their careers, have no incentives to innovate and work harder, and have no ownerships of private property.

Intersections are some of the most dangerous parts of the roadway. What factors cause them to be unsafe? How can driver actions
Tresset [83]

Answer:

What factors make intersections particularly dangerous?

This is part of the road where multiple paths intersect and drivers usually misjudge most situations associated with these paths and how they should proceed .

How can drivers actions reduce the dangers of intersection?

They need to follow every single road or driving procedures associated with intersections for example if a vehicle on your left reaches the intersection after you , you should continue driving but if it arrives first you must make sure that you yield .

When two vehicles arrives at the intersection simultaneously from different roads especially in an uncontrolled intersection where there are no stop signs or any road signs the one on the right has a right of way and the driver on the left need to yield .

Whether it is uncontrolled or controlled intersection drivers need to approach them with caution and not assume that the other drive will do that on their behalf .
